Negligence
18-wheelers are huge and often involved in accidents that cause serious injuries or deaths. When this happens lawsuits against trucking firms are common and can easily be worth millions or hundreds of millions of dollars.
A competent lawyer will be able to identify the liable parties in your accident and ensure that you are compensated for all your losses. This will include medical expenses loss of income, damages to property, legal costs, and non-economic losses like pain and suffering.
In many cases trucking companies can be found guilty of negligence if they fail to adhere to federal safety regulations or if they fail to supervise their drivers. It could be because employees are allowed to drive tired or taking prescription drugs that can affect driving. The driver may also be culpable for failing to secure their cargo or driving recklessly. These errors can lead to devastating accidents that destroy other vehicles and their passengers. A successful lawsuit will demand the trucking company be compensated damages for these injuries. This money will help victims recover from their injuries and get back to their normal lives.
